Alpha Ltd is a public company whose shares are listed on the TSX and has a December 31 fiscal year-end. In early 2020, Alpha entered into a contract with Beta Ltd. to deliver 250 photocopiers and provide two years of on-site maintenance service. The total contract consideration was $300,000. Alpha sells individual photocopiers at a price of $1,100 each. The maintenance agreements are also sold separately, with a two-year maintenance cost being $230 per photocopier. On April 1, Alpha delivered the 250 photocopiers. At various times throughout April to December, Alpha sent its technicians to do regular maintenance on all the machines.
Required:
- Allocate the transaction price of $300,000 to the two separate performance obligations (photocopiers and maintenance service )
- Give the journal entries to be made by Alpha related to the contract on April 1, 2020. Ignore the cost of goods sold. Assume sales are on credit.

- What is the total amount of maintenance revenue from this contract to be recognized in 2020?
